Transaction 96b6fadbed01ee596de2a85b4fe350ec991007616376350dd19bccbf1196191b
1 Input
1 Outputs
- 96b6fadbed01ee596de2a85b4fe350ec991007616376350dd19bccbf1196191b:0
value 991400
address 1Mu5WMDWZqGaAFBvdWpDLVKemzp3K68MDw